MouseEventArgs.GetPosition(IInputElement) Method

Returns the position of the mouse pointer relative to the specified element.
public:
System::Windows::Point GetPosition(System::Windows::IInputElement ^ relativeTo);
public System.Windows.Point GetPosition (System.Windows.IInputElement relativeTo);
member this.GetPosition : System.Windows.IInputElement -> System.Windows.Point
Public Function GetPosition (relativeTo As IInputElement) As Point
Parameters
- relativeTo
- IInputElement
The element to use as the frame of reference for calculating the position of the mouse pointer.
Returns
The x- and y-coordinates of the mouse pointer position relative to the specified object.
Remarks
The point (0,0) is the upper-left corner of the frame of reference.
The static Mouse.GetPosition method can also be used to obtain the position of the mouse.
